WWE has been on a mission to create a new crop of heel characters, and while some have been met with lukewarm reception, one man stands out as a shining example of a truly despicable antagonist: Gunther. According to wrestling legend Kevin Nash, Gunther’s current run as a heel is a rare sight in the modern era of WWE, and it’s a testament to the Austrian’s exceptional in-ring skills and charismatic persona.
A Return to Form for WWE’s Heels
In a recent episode of Kliq This, Nash expressed his admiration for Gunther’s ability to generate real heat from the audience. Nash, a member of the legendary Kliq faction that included members like Shawn Michaels, Triple H, and Scott Hall, is no stranger to the world of professional wrestling. Having spent years in the ring and behind the scenes, Nash has a keen eye for talent, and he believes that Gunther is something special.
“What I love about Gunther is that he’s not just a guy who’s getting heat because he’s a heel,” Nash said. “He’s getting heat because he’s a believable, despicable person who doesn’t care about anyone but himself. That’s what makes him so effective.”
